> > Is this "pitch change" an actual phenomenon in > > pianos or an > > artifact of sampling in the computer? > > From: baoli liu <baoli_liu@yahoo.com> > > ...So even the most decent concert piano may > have a few notes with noticeble "false beats". > > Tunelab,as well as other ETDs, are very sesitive > devices,which will show the smallest pitch deviation. I agree that it's a slight false beat. If it's a case where the pitch goes slightly sharp and then settles down a little flatter, I usually wait it settles down and then use that as its pitch.
